Prayers for World Peace Every Sunday, 10:00–11:00 am with Gen Kelsang Suma Peace will never arise in this world unless we ourselves develop inner peace... Here we focus on cultivating mental peace and then, through our actions and example, sowing the seeds of peace wherever we are. Prayer is a powerful force, and by coming together in this way with peace as our goal we are gathering the conditions for wars and conflict to end, and making positive change in our own and others’ lives. Everyone is welcome to join us for a short teaching, prayers and meditation for world peace. (no set charge, but donations welcome). |

The Root of All Suffering: Our Own Ignorance Saturday 15th November 10:00 am–12:00 noon $10.00 Where does our suffering come from? Will our problems and pain ever end? Buddha taught that ignorance in the mind underlies all suffering, and he provided methods to remove our confusion, making freedom possible. Explore the Buddhist view on how to solve our human problems. |
